Transaction fe8126ec6cbc2ca798be67f339d9ad5dacf608e8273d18a20772d3b1be4e71ab
1 Input
1 Output
-
fe8126ec6cbc2ca798be67f339d9ad5dacf608e8273d18a20772d3b1be4e71ab:0
- value
- 1173869
- script pubkey
- OP_0 OP_PUSHBYTES_20 4ebcecc1e177ad5207bf85ae878e1c81e6b0a6f4
- address
- bc1qf67wes0pw7k4ypalskhg0rsus8ntpfh5rz0fu3